Merge tag 'mips_6.15'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mips/linux
Pull MIPS updates from Thomas Bogendoerfer: - Add support for multi-cluster configuration - Add quirks for enabling multi-cluster mode on EyeQ6 - Add DTS clocks for ralink - Cleanup realtek DTS - Other cleanups and fixes * tag 'mips_6.15'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mips/linux: (35 commits) MIPS: config: omega2+, vocore2: enable CLK_MTMIPS arch: mips: defconfig: Drop obsolete CONFIG_NET_CLS_TCINDEX MIPS: cm: Fix warning if MIPS_CM is disabled MIPS: Fix Macro name MIPS: ds1287: Match ds1287_set_base_clock() function types MIPS: cevt-ds1287: Add missing ds1287.h include MIPS: dec: Declare which_prom() as static MIPS: Loongson2ef: Replace deprecated strncpy() with strscpy() mips: dts: ralink: mt7628a: update system controller node and its consumers mips: dts: ralink: mt7620a: update system controller node and its consumers mips: dts: ralink: rt3883: update system controller node and its consumers mips: dts: ralink: rt3050: update system controller node and its consumers mips: dts: ralink: rt2880: update system controller node and its consumers dt-bindings: clock: add clock definitions for Ralink SoCs MIPS: Use arch specific syscall name match function mips: dts: realtek: Add restart to Cisco SG220-26P mips: dts: realtek: Add RTL838x SoC peripherals mips: dts: realtek: Replace uart clock property mips: dts: realtek: Correct uart interrupt-parent mips: dts: realtek: Add SoC IRQ node for RTL838x ...

@@ -0,0 +1,57 @@
|
||||
# SPDX-License-Identifier: (GPL-2.0-only OR BSD-2-Clause)
|
||||
%YAML 1.2
|
||||
---
|
||||
$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/mips/mti,mips-cm.yaml#
|
||||
$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
|
||||
|
||||
title: MIPS Coherence Manager
|
||||
|
||||
description:
|
||||
The Coherence Manager (CM) is responsible for establishing the
|
||||
global ordering of requests from all elements of the system and
|
||||
sending the correct data back to the requester. It supports Cache
|
||||
to Cache transfers.
|
||||
https://training.mips.com/cps_mips/PDF/CPS_Introduction.pdf
|
||||
https://training.mips.com/cps_mips/PDF/Coherency_Manager.pdf
|
||||
|
||||
maintainers:
|
||||
- Jiaxun Yang <jiaxun.yang@flygoat.com>
|
||||
|
||||
properties:
|
||||
compatible:
|
||||
oneOf:
|
||||
- const: mti,mips-cm
|
||||
- const: mobileye,eyeq6-cm
|
||||
description:
|
||||
On EyeQ6 the HCI (Hardware Cache Initialization) information for
|
||||
the L2 cache in multi-cluster configuration is broken.
|
||||
|
||||
reg:
|
||||
description:
|
||||
Base address and size of the Global Configuration Registers
|
||||
referred to as CMGCR.They are the system programmer's interface
|
||||
to the Coherency Manager. Their location in the memory map is
|
||||
determined at core build time. In a functional system, the base
|
||||
address is provided by the Coprocessor 0, but some
|
||||
System-on-Chip (SoC) designs may not provide an accurate address
|
||||
that needs to be described statically.
|
||||
|
||||
maxItems: 1
|
||||
|
||||
required:
|
||||
- compatible
|
||||
|
||||
additionalProperties: false
|
||||
|
||||
examples:
|
||||
- |
|
||||
coherency-manager@1fbf8000 {
|
||||
compatible = "mti,mips-cm";
|
||||
reg = <0x1bde8000 0x8000>;
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
- |
|
||||
coherency-manager {
|
||||
compatible = "mobileye,eyeq6-cm";
|
||||
};
|
||||
...

static void init_cluster_l2(void)
|
||||
{
|
||||
u32 stat, seq_state;
|
||||
unsigned timeout;
|
||||
u32 l2_cfg, l2sm_cop, result;
|
||||
|
||||
while (!mips_cm_is_l2_hci_broken) {
|
||||
l2_cfg = read_gcr_redir_l2_ram_config();
|
||||
|
||||
/* If HCI is not supported, use the state machine below */
|
||||
if (!(l2_cfg & CM_GCR_L2_RAM_CONFIG_PRESENT))
|
||||
break;
|
||||
if (!(l2_cfg & CM_GCR_L2_RAM_CONFIG_HCI_SUPPORTED))
|
||||
break;
|
||||
|
||||
/* If the HCI_DONE bit is set, we're finished */
|
||||
if (l2_cfg & CM_GCR_L2_RAM_CONFIG_HCI_DONE)
|
||||
return;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
l2sm_cop = read_gcr_redir_l2sm_cop();
|
||||
if (WARN(!(l2sm_cop & C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_PRESENT),
|
||||
"L2 init not supported on this system yet"))
|
||||
return;
|
||||
|
||||
/* Clear L2 tag registers */
|
||||
write_gcr_redir_l2_tag_state(0);
|
||||
write_gcr_redir_l2_ecc(0);
|
||||
|
||||
/* Ensure the L2 tag writes complete before the state machine starts */
|
||||
mb();
|
||||
|
||||
/* Wait for the L2 state machine to be idle */
|
||||
do {
|
||||
l2sm_cop = read_gcr_redir_l2sm_cop();
|
||||
} while (l2sm_cop & C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_RUNNING);
|
||||
|
||||
/* Start a store tag operation */
|
||||
l2sm_cop = C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_TYPE_IDX_STORETAG;
|
||||
l2sm_cop <<= __ffs(C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_TYPE);
|
||||
l2sm_cop |= C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_CMD_START;
|
||||
write_gcr_redir_l2sm_cop(l2sm_cop);
|
||||
|
||||
/* Ensure the state machine starts before we poll for completion */
|
||||
mb();
|
||||
|
||||
/* Wait for the operation to be complete */
|
||||
do {
|
||||
l2sm_cop = read_gcr_redir_l2sm_cop();
|
||||
result = l2sm_cop & C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_RESULT;
|
||||
result >>= __ffs(C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_RESULT);
|
||||
} while (!result);
|
||||
|
||||
WARN(result != CM_GCR_L2SM_COP_RESULT_DONE_OK,
|
||||
"L2 state machine failed cache init with error %u\n", result);
|
||||
}
